Taxonomy Alkaloids and derivatives > Harmala alkaloids
IUPAC Name [2-(9H-pyrido[3,4-b]indol-1-yl)furan-3-yl]methanol
SMILES (Canonical) C1=CC=C2C(=C1)C3=C(N2)C(=NC=C3)C4=C(C=CO4)CO
SMILES (Isomeric) C1=CC=C2C(=C1)C3=C(N2)C(=NC=C3)C4=C(C=CO4)CO
InChI InChI=1S/C16H12N2O2/c19-9-10-6-8-20-16(10)15-14-12(5-7-17-15)11-3-1-2-4-13(11)18-14/h1-8,18-19H,9H2
InChI Key YFNWKBJECXFSDK-UHFFFAOYSA-N

Physical and Chemical Properties

Top
Molecular Formula C16H12N2O2
Molecular Weight 264.28 g/mol
Exact Mass 264.089877630 g/mol
Topological Polar Surface Area (TPSA) 62.00 Ų
XlogP 2.20
Atomic LogP (AlogP) 3.47
H-Bond Acceptor 3
H-Bond Donor 2
Rotatable Bonds 2
